§ 203 — Witnesses; persons competent

Del. Code tit. 12, § 203 (2026).
Text
(a)Any person generally competent to be a witness may act as a witness to a will.
(b)A will or any provision thereof is not invalid because the will is signed by an interested person.

Legislative History
Code 1852, § 1646; Code 1915, § 3242; Code 1935, § 3706; 12 Del. C. 1953, § 103; 59 Del. Laws, c. 384, § 1
